基于相位与区域分割的视差估计算法

摘要: 提出一种结合小波变换与图像分割的立体匹配算法。该算法利用双树复小波多通道提取立体像对带通相位信息作为匹配基元,求取初始视差场。针对单独通道提出一个相位匹配程度方程式,将视差计算归结为求解该方程的极大值。结合图像分割与视差平面拟合的方法对初始视差场进行修正,从而得到精度较高的密集视差图。实验结果表明,该算法结构简单,能快速有效地产生密集视差场。

关键词: 视差估计, 相位匹配, 双树复小波变换, 图像分割

Abstract: This paper proposes a stereo matching algorithm combing wavelet transform and image segmentation. Multi-resolution phase acquired from Dual-Tree Complex Wavelet Transform(DTCWT) is used to get initial disparity map. For each scale, an equation is presented to measure the matching degree. Initial disparity map is amended into a high-resolution disparity map via color segmentation and disparity plane estimation. Experimental results show that the method is simple, and can achieve high accuracy and efficiency.

Key words: disparity estimation, phase matching, Dual-Tree Complex Wavelet Transform(DTCWT), image segmentation
